高级嵌入式软件工程师在物联网领域的发展前景

随着科技的飞速发展,物联网(IoT)逐渐成为全球范围内最具潜力的领域之一。在这一领域,高级嵌入式软件工程师扮演着至关重要的角色。本文将深入探讨高级嵌入式软件工程师在物联网领域的发展前景,分析其面临的机遇与挑战,以及如何应对这些挑战。

一、物联网的发展趋势

物联网是指通过互联网将各种设备连接起来,实现设备与设备、设备与人、人与物之间的智能交互。近年来,物联网发展迅速,以下为其主要趋势:

  1. 市场规模不断扩大:据预测,全球物联网市场规模将从2019年的3530亿美元增长到2025年的12300亿美元,年复合增长率达到24.3%。

  2. 应用场景日益丰富:物联网技术已广泛应用于智能家居、智慧城市、工业自动化、医疗健康等领域。

  3. 技术不断创新:边缘计算、人工智能、5G等新技术不断涌现,为物联网发展提供强大动力。

二、高级嵌入式软件工程师在物联网领域的角色

在物联网领域,高级嵌入式软件工程师主要负责以下工作:

  1. 硬件选型与集成:根据项目需求,选择合适的硬件设备,并进行系统集成。

  2. 软件开发与优化:负责嵌入式软件的设计、开发、调试和优化,确保系统稳定运行。

  3. 系统集成与测试:将硬件和软件进行集成,并进行系统测试,确保系统功能完善。

  4. 技术支持与维护:为用户提供技术支持,解决使用过程中遇到的问题,并负责系统维护。

三、高级嵌入式软件工程师在物联网领域的机遇

  1. 市场需求旺盛:随着物联网市场的不断扩大,对高级嵌入式软件工程师的需求也将持续增长。

  2. 技术挑战与创新空间:物联网领域技术不断更新,为高级嵌入式软件工程师提供了广阔的创新空间。

  3. 薪资待遇优厚:高级嵌入式软件工程师在物联网领域的薪资待遇相对较高,且随着经验的积累,薪资水平有望进一步提升。

四、高级嵌入式软件工程师在物联网领域的挑战

  1. 技术更新迅速:物联网领域技术更新迅速,要求高级嵌入式软件工程师不断学习新技术。

  2. 跨学科知识要求高:物联网涉及多个学科领域,如计算机科学、电子工程、通信等,要求高级嵌入式软件工程师具备跨学科知识。

  3. 安全风险:物联网设备众多,安全问题不容忽视,高级嵌入式软件工程师需关注并解决安全问题。

五、案例分析

以智能家居为例,高级嵌入式软件工程师需要具备以下能力:

  1. 硬件选型与集成:选择合适的传感器、控制器等硬件设备,并将其集成到智能家居系统中。

  2. 软件开发与优化:开发智能家居控制软件,实现设备间的互联互通,并对软件进行优化,提高系统性能。

  3. 系统集成与测试:将硬件和软件进行集成,并进行系统测试,确保智能家居系统稳定运行。

  4. 技术支持与维护:为用户提供技术支持,解决使用过程中遇到的问题,并负责系统维护。

总结

高级嵌入式软件工程师在物联网领域具有广阔的发展前景。面对机遇与挑战,高级嵌入式软件工程师应不断学习新技术,提高自身综合素质,以应对物联网领域的快速发展。

猜你喜欢:猎头招聘